Topeka Daily Capital, Wednesday, July 3, 1968, page 17:
Mrs. Vida Robinson

Graves services will be at 10 a.m. Friday in Mount Hope Cemetery for Mrs. Vida Belle Robinson, 77, 2928 E. 6th, who died Tuesday morning in a Topeka hospital where she was admitted Friday. Wall-Diffenderfer Mortuary is in charge of arrangements.

She was born March 16, 1891, at Council Hills, Ill. She had been a Topeka resident since 1952. She was employed by the Kansas State Department of Taxation and Revenue until her retirement in 1956.
Mrs. Robinson was a member of the Third Christian Church and the American Legion Auxiliary in Topeka and Kansas City.

Her husband, Leon D. Robinson, died in 1953.
Survivors include a daughter, Mrs. Alyce Williams, of the home; a son, Martin Jack Robinson; two sisters, Mrs. Charles Tucker Sr., 3003 Burlingame Road, and Mrs. Albert Schmidt, Freeport, Ill.; four grandchildren and four great-grandchildren.
